2 Functional Description
The MX510 and MX512 Navigation CDU models are generally described in this manual as
MX51x Control and Display Unit (CDU). Their general operating features are identical and
will be described in common details in this manual. Specific model number will be called
in areas where they differ from one another.
CDU Congurations
The MX510 and MX512 Navigation System is available in several configurations. Please
refer to the Auxiliary Unit Information section of the manual to view sample screens to
identify your particular model. Described below are the various configurations and their
differences.
Basic CDU conguration
The MX510 has two (2) bidirectional user NMEA ports while the MX512 has nine (9)
bidirectional user NMEA ports. Both models have one (1) high-speed Local Area Network
(LAN) port and two USB ports. The basic GPS navigation model includes the CDU and a
smart GPS antenna

MX51x DGPS
The MX51x DGPS model is supplied with a smart DGPS antenna with built-in Beacon
receiver (MX521A B-10 DGPS). The smart DGPS antenna unit can achieve better than 1
meter accuracy in areas with good beacon differential coverage.

MX51x/BR
The MX51x/BR configuration is a dual-control system where two MX51x (one operating
as a master and the other as a slave) is supplied. Only one MX521A smart DGPS
antenna is required. The antenna unit is connected only to the master unit. The two
MX51x CDUs communicate via the high-speed LAN port.
LAN port must be setup before enabling this feature. The units can be connected
together using an ethernet crossover cable (when connected directly) or through a hub/
switch/router. See section 4 of this manual for setup details.
